US stock futures are higher this morning, as investors are awaiting manufacturing data and minutes from the Federal Reserve's December meeting. Futures for the Dow Jones Industrial Average surged 206 points to 12,356.00 and S&P 500 index futures rose 21.70 points to 1,274.30. Nasdaq 100 futures jumped 43.50 points to 2,318.00.

US stocks closed lower on Friday, with the Dow Jones Industrial Average dropping 0.57% to 12,217.56, the S&P 500 index declining 0.43% to 1,257.60 and the Nasdaq 100 index dipping 0.33% to 2,605.15.

US markets were closed Monday for a holiday.

The Institute for Supply Management's manufacturing report for December will be released at 10 a.m. ET. The US Federal Open Market Committee is scheduled to release minutes from its December 13 monetary-policy meeting at 2 p.m. ET.

Team Inc (NYSE: TISI) is projected to post its Q2 earnings at $0.49 per share on revenue of $154.10 million. Progress Software Corp (NASDAQ: PRGS) is estimated to post its FQ4 earnings at $0.33 per share on revenue of $133.54 million.

The US Defense Department awarded Boeing Co (NYSE: BA) a $3.48 billion contract over seven years to develop, test, engineer and manufacture missile defense systems.

Verizon Communications Inc (NYSE: VZ) dropped its plan to charge a $2 “convenience fee” on some bill payments.

Noah Education Holdings Ltd (NYSE: NED) announced the resignation of its Chief Executive Jerry He for personal reasons effective Sunday.

European markets were mostly higher today. The STOXX Europe 600 Index gained 0.69%, London's FTSE 100 Index moved up 1.24%, French CAC 40 index fell 0.45% and German DAX 30 index gained 1.03%.

Asian markets ended higher, with Australia's S&P/ASX 200 moving up 1.08%. Hong Kong's Hang Seng Index rose 2.4032% and India's Sensex surged 2.72%.

February gold futures surged around $24 to $1,590.70 an ounce. However, February oil futures gained $2.14 to $100.97 a barrel.

The dollar index (DXY) declined 0.5% to 79.772.
